Berryville profile


Living in Berryville



Berryville is a somewhat small city located in the state of Arkansas. With a population of 5,754 people and three associated neighborhoods, Berryville is the 64th largest community in Arkansas.

And if you like science, one thing you'll find is that Berryville has lots of scientists living in town - whether they be life scientists, physical scientists (like astronomers), or social scientists (like geographers!). So, if you're scientific-minded, you might like it here too.

Residents of the city have the good fortune of having one of the shortest daily commutes compared to the rest of the country. On average, they spend only 16.13 minutes getting to work every day.

Being a small city, Berryville does not have a public transit system used by locals to get to and from work.

The percentage of adults in Berryville with college degrees is slightly lower than the national average of 21.84% for all communities. 14.66% of adults in Berryville have a bachelor's degree or advanced degree.

The per capita income in Berryville in 2022 was $20,469, which is low income relative to Arkansas and the nation. This equates to an annual income of $81,876 for a family of four. However, Berryville contains both very wealthy and poor people as well.

Berryville is an extremely ethnically-diverse city. The people who call Berryville home describe themselves as belonging to a variety of racial and ethnic groups. The greatest number of Berryville residents report their race to be White, followed by Native American. Berryville also has a sizeable Hispanic population (people of Hispanic origin can be of any race). People of Hispanic or Latino origin account for 23.13% of the city’s residents. Important ancestries of people in Berryville include English, German, Irish, European, and Ukrainian.

The most common language spoken in Berryville is English. Other important languages spoken here include Spanish and Pacific Island languages.
